Tage Kene-Okafor / TechCrunch:
Cairo-based Capiter, which offers a B2B service for manufacturers to distribute products and merchants to access them, raises $33M Series A — Funding startups that help manufacturers and sellers distribute products and merchants access them on a single platform keeps soaring across Africa.
